Transaction 3bfc768d3c63e36ddb231094f3c0ba4ac2058912f8657ff10750afbb479a765c

2 Input
2 Outputs
  • 3bfc768d3c63e36ddb231094f3c0ba4ac2058912f8657ff10750afbb479a765c:0
  • value  1022579
    address  1DYtRVj8gFo2dPs6SASrxbusgT8WLKXKXW
  • 3bfc768d3c63e36ddb231094f3c0ba4ac2058912f8657ff10750afbb479a765c:1
  • value  20160600
    address  1PtoDq5LJZ3PTxVa4yhE6nxFiGHEN1LJp8